Rumah > pembangunan bahagian belakang > tutorial php > Latihan rentetan PHP 4: Tentukan sama ada rentetan mengandungi perkataan tertentu

Latihan rentetan PHP 4: Tentukan sama ada rentetan mengandungi perkataan tertentu

藏色散人
Lepaskan: 2023-04-10 13:12:02
asal
2729 orang telah melayarinya

Dalam "Latihan Rentetan PHP 3: 4 Kaedah untuk Menukar Saiz Rentetan", kami memperkenalkan empat kaedah biasa untuk menukar kes rentetan Dalam artikel ini, kami akan meneruskan dengan rentetan rentetan mengandungi rentetan tertentu.

Malah, terdapat cara yang sangat mudah untuk mencapai pertimbangan sedemikian Mari kita lihat kod secara langsung:

adalah seperti berikut:

<?php
$str1 = &#39;The quick brown fox jumps over the lazy dog.&#39;;
if (strpos($str1,&#39;jumps&#39;) !== false)
{
    echo &#39;特定词出现了&#39;;
}
else
{
    echo &#39;特定词未出现&#39;;
}
Salin selepas log masuk

Dalam kod ini. , kami mencipta Pembolehubah rentetan $str1 dicipta, dan kemudian kami secara rawak menentukan perkataan "melompat" dan semak untuk melihat sama ada perkataan ini wujud dalam $str1 melalui pernyataan if...else

Mari kita lihat penghakiman pertama Keputusan:

Latihan rentetan PHP 4: Tentukan sama ada rentetan mengandungi perkataan tertentu

Seperti yang ditunjukkan dalam gambar, keputusan mengatakan "perkataan khusus muncul daripada kod di atas, ia adalah benar.

Jadi di sini kita menggunakan fungsi strpos dan pengendali "!==".

Fungsi terbina dalam strpos() dalam PHP digunakan untuk mencari kejadian pertama rentetan dalam rentetan lain Sintaksnya ialah "strpos(string,find,start)", di mana rentetan parameter menentukan rentetan carian String, find menentukan rentetan untuk ditemui, mula adalah pilihan dan menentukan tempat untuk memulakan carian; fungsi ini mengembalikan kedudukan kejadian pertama rentetan dalam rentetan lain dan mengembalikan FALSE jika rentetan itu tidak ditemui.

Perlu diambil perhatian bahawa fungsi strpos() adalah sensitif huruf besar-besaran.

!== bermaksud "pasti tidak sama" dalam pengendali perbandingan dan !== bermaksud "tidak sama" dalam operator tatasusunan.

Akhir sekali, saya syorkan membaca "php mengesan sama ada rentetan mengandungi rentetan ". Syorkan kursus klasik "

Pemprosesan Rentetan PHP (Edisi Sutra Jantung Gadis Jade)

", ianya percuma~ datang dan belajar!

Atas ialah kandungan terperinci Latihan rentetan PHP 4: Tentukan sama ada rentetan mengandungi perkataan tertentu.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an